Hey all, I'm looking to get into a Lexus. A little background: I'm a combat vet w/a constantly sore back, and the '92 Wrangler doesn't make a very comfy daily driver. I'm in school training as an automotive technician, and we work with Toyota. I've been largely impressed with the quality of their vehicles. I'm not a fan of the FWD platform, so I've been drawn to the Lexus RWD offerings. I would like a strong, reliable platform as a daily driver, that will put up with spirited driving. Just today a mechanic told me to go for the inline six. Can anybody give me a good rundown on these cars? Is there a "better" year, engine, trans, etc? Also, I'm more inclined to a timing chain over a belt, but let me know the real deal here. I would say my budget is probably 12k or less, so brand new is out, but I'm not opposed to getting an older model if they are better. Thanks so much!
 
The flagship of Lexus has always been the LS model. All LS cars are V8 powered. While the inline 6 found in the 1992-2000 SC300 and the IS300 responds the best to turbocharging without boost it just will never have the smooth torquey effortless cruising of the V8s.

I have a 99 LS400 and before that a 96 LS400. I have driven between them nearly 200k relatively trouble free miles. Smooth quiet and relatively powerful. Soft suspension that will hold a corner far quicker than expected. Do some research here as there are changes by model year mainly
1990-1994, 230hp (250hp rated 230hp actual) 4 liter V8, rwd, timing belt, 4spd auto, 8.0 seconds 0-60mph, 150mph top speed in theory
1995-1997, 260hp 4 liter V8, rwd, timing belt, 4spd auto, 7.0s 0-60mph, 149mph top speed limited, would do 155mph unlimited
1998-2000, 290hp 4 liter V8, rwd, timing belt, 5spd auto, 6.3s 0-60mph, 149mph top speed, limited, would do 160+mph unlimited
2001-2003, 290hp 4.3 liter V8, rwd, timing belt, 5spd auto, 6.3s 0-60mph, 128mph top speed, limited, would do 160+mph unlimited
2004-2006, 290hp 4.3 liter V8, rwd, timing belt, 6spd auto, 5.9s 0-60mph, 128mph top speed, limited, would do 160+mph unlimited
For the money a clean 1998-2000 may be your best bet.
The 2004-2006 is very sweet especially the sport model but these will be way above your price point.

Don't let the timing belt worry you. Smooth, quiet, durable with 90k change intervals and last roughly 130+k miles on those that ignore service.

From a comfort level the seats in the 2001+ LS430s are the best.
